Durability and Maintenance
When it comes to durability, vinyl fencing is the clear winner. Vinyl fences are made of a PVC composite material, which is resistant to rotting, warping, and pests. This makes it a great option for humid and rainy climates, like Yorba Linda. Additionally, vinyl fences require minimal maintenance and can last up to 30 years with proper care. On the other hand, wood fences are prone to rotting, warping, and insect infestations. They also require regular maintenance, such as staining and sealing, to prevent damage.
Aesthetics and Customization
In terms of aesthetics, wood fencing may have an edge over vinyl. Wood has a traditional and natural look that can add charm and character to your property. Wood fences also offer more customization options, such as different stains and paint colors, to match your personal style and preference. On the other hand, vinyl fencing comes in limited colors and designs, but it can mimic the look of wood without the maintenance hassle.
Cost
When it comes to cost, vinyl fencing may have a higher upfront cost compared to wood fencing. However, when you factor in the cost of maintenance and repairs, vinyl fences can actually save you money in the long run. Wood fences require regular upkeep, which can add up over time. Vinyl fences, on the other hand, only require occasional cleaning with soap and water.
